After spending quite some time researching and experimenting, I’m thrilled to share my successful integration of both water-based and electric underfloor heating systems using KNX components. This setup allows me to efficiently manage my home’s heating needs throughout the year.
Initially, I faced challenges in coordinating the two systems seamlessly. However, by utilizing the SpaceLogic KNX valve drive controller alongside my existing electrical setup, I managed to create a system that automatically adapts to seasonal changes. During colder months, the electric underfloor heating kicks in quickly to provide instant warmth, while the water-based system maintains a steady, energy-efficient temperature.
One of the key insights I gained was the importance of proper configuration in the KNX programming. Ensuring that the electric system operates independently of the water-based one was crucial to avoid conflicts and inefficiencies. I also found that setting up clear automation rules within my KNX system made the transition between heating modes smooth and user-friendly.
For those considering a similar setup, I recommend thoroughly testing each component individually before integrating them. This helps in identifying and resolving any compatibility issues early on.
